Job summary
A leading hardware services provider seeks a skilled HVAC technician in Boston, MA. You will diagnose and service residential HVAC systems, handle maintenance calls, and ensure excellent customer communication. Required are 3+ years of experience, EPA Certification, and a focus on customer service. Join a team committed to community values, where your role contributes to meaningful local service and career growth opportunities. Contract includes bonuses and comprehensive health benefits.
Qualifications
Min 3 years Residential HVAC experience required.
Must have EPA Universal Certification.
Strong troubleshooting and diagnostic skills necessary.
Responsibilities
Diagnose, service, and repair residential HVAC systems.
Handle service calls, maintenance, and warranty work.
Communicate clearly with homeowners about system issues and solutions.
